- 博客(30)
- 收藏
- 关注
原创 ll
#include<iostream>#include<iomanip>using namespace std;#define PI 3.1415926535class Pool{private: double radius;//池子的半径 double width;//走道的宽度 const static double railPrice; const ...
2018-04-07 00:48:16 194
原创 画上背景和坦克
背景知识Component类提供了和绘图有关的三个方法分别是paint(Graphicsg) 而paint()方法在加载窗口时会被自动调用update(Graphicsg)repaint()调用repaint()可以实现绘图的更新,repaint会先调用update()方法,而update()方法会调用paint()方法实现图像的重绘在原来的代码中添加如下的代码(红色为添加的代码)import ...
2018-04-03 00:06:57 604
原创 第一步 写一个窗口并且实现关闭的功能
新建一个名为TankClient的类 并在类中添加如下的代码import java.awt.Frame;import java.awt.event.WindowAdapter;import java.awt.event.WindowEvent;public class TankClient extends Frame{ public void lunchFrame(){ this....
2018-04-02 01:18:35 747
原创 用JavaSE写一个坦克大战小游戏
俗话说千里之行始于足下,由于自己的编程基础太差,学完JavaSE之后又没有做过什么小项目练练手,所以打算通过这个小项目来练练手,锻炼锻炼自己的编程基础。预计学习时间将在一周之内。通过这个博客来记录构筑这个小游戏的每一步。...
2018-04-02 01:06:07 1507 1
原创 GitHub使用指南
网上GitHub的教程很多 但有些比较零碎 现在就搬运一些比较好懂的使用教程吧1.关于如何把项目上传到GitHub上http://blog.csdn.net/qq_31852701/article/details/52944312
2017-12-19 20:54:19 232
原创 用Java实现的一个密码验证 以及Java异常处理流程和runtime异常以及checked异常之间的区别
内容还是很简单的 主要还是为了复习一下一些基础的内容import java.util.Scanner;public class Index{ public static void main(String[] args) { Scanner scan=new Scanner(System.in); String str; while(true){ str=scan.nex
2017-12-17 15:55:42 595
原创 JTextField
import java.awt.BorderLayout;import java.awt.Container;import java.awt.event.WindowAdapter;import javax.swing.JFrame;import javax.swing.JPanel;import javax.swing.JTextField;import com.sun.glas
2017-12-14 01:13:00 449
原创 实现Server和client端的通信
import java.io.IOException;import java.net.*;import java.io.*;import java.util.Scanner;public class Server { public static void main(String[] args){ try(ServerSocket ss=new ServerSocket(3001);Scanner
2017-11-21 23:34:09 601
原创 多线程实现间隔打印
public class TestThread{ public synchronized void x() { System.out.println("rgreighreiohgioer"); notify(); try{ wait(); }catch(InterruptedException e){
2017-11-19 21:42:09 563
原创 使用Callable和Future创建线程
import java.util.concurrent.Callable;import java.util.concurrent.FutureTask;public class TestThread { public static void main(String[] args){ TestThread rt=new TestThread(); FutureTask task=n
2017-11-18 13:22:04 1755
原创 输出一张图到窗口中
package indi.zzy.mygame.test;import java.awt.Graphics;import java.awt.Image;import java.awt.image.BufferedImage;import java.io.File;import javax.imageio.ImageIO;public class GameUtil { pri
2017-11-15 22:06:27 173
原创 括号配对(用栈实现)
#include#include#includeusing namespace std;int main(){ char ch; stackmystack; bool isMatching = true; while ((ch=getchar())!='\n') { switch (ch) { case '(': case '[': mystack.
2017-11-12 11:24:31 594
原创 Java文件操作自己做的一些小实验
实验1 C:\Users\zzy\Desktop\目标:在此目录下的test文件夹下的test1文件夹下创建一个名为test的文本文件import java.io.File;public class FileTest { public static void main(String[] args)throws Exception{ File file=
2017-11-12 11:19:47 351
原创 Java 异常处理作业
import java.util.Scanner;public class Grade { private double grade; public Grade(){ this.grade=0; } public Grade(int grade){ this.grade=grade; } public double getGrade
2017-11-08 23:59:38 542
原创 MySQL第一次实验的一些操作
还是别人不要看系列2333333 mysql> SHOEDATABASES -> ;ERROR 1064 (42000): You have an error inyour SQL syntax; check the manual that corresponds to your MySQL server versionfor the righ
2017-10-31 15:21:05 411
原创 MySQL的配置及一些基础操作
其他人不要看23333333第一章 MySQL的配置 1.如何查看服务2.配置的环境变量是什么此电脑属性 高级 环境变量环境变量相当于给系统或用户应用程序设置的一些参数, 具体起什么作用这当然和具体的环境变量相关. 比如path, 是告诉系统, 当要求系统运行一个程序而没有告诉它程序所在的完整路径时, 系统除了在当前目录下面寻找此程序外, 还应到哪些目录下去寻找
2017-10-31 15:10:43 179
原创 Java面向对象基础知识复习
做为一个初学者,有一段时间没有学习Java了,所以未免比较生疏,所以拿出一天的时间来复习一下一些基础的东西 JDK中的Javadoc工具将源代码当中的文档注释提取成一份系统API下载Java8的系统API http://www.oracle.com/只能写在类和方法之前 Java程序的编译运行方式 先编译成平台无关的字节码,运行时再由解释器解释运行 堆区引用
2017-10-31 15:08:26 216
原创 JS实现复选框的全选和全不选
无标题文档 请选择你爱好: 音乐 登山 游泳 阅读 打球 跑步 请输入您要选择爱好的序号,序号为1-6: function checkall(){ var hobby = document.getElementsByTagNa
2017-10-15 20:25:27 2680 2
原创 JS实现加减乘除四则运算器
事件 function count(){ var txt1Value = document.getElementById("txt1").value; var txt2Value = document.getElementById("txt2").value; var operator = docum
2017-10-15 19:55:26 3264
原创 网页xx秒将返回测JS代码的实现
初学者 不要笑2333333333333 浏览器对象 操作成功 秒后将返回主页 返回 var atTime = 5; function clock(){ document.getElementById("clock").innerHTML = atTime; --atTime; if(at
2017-10-15 19:53:43 321
转载 innerHTML和value属性的区别
1.innerText是id为object的闭合标签内的文本,输入输出的是转义文本(字符串); (label控件用innerText有效)2.innerHtml是标签内的文本,输入输出到该DOM内部纯HTML代码(流); (获得td、div等html元素时候,它们是没有value或是text属性,只能用innerHtml)3.value是表单元素特有的属性,输入输出的是
2017-10-14 16:32:20 402
原创 大二上转专业的规划以及别人的意见的记录
大佬的话1.绩点不是特别重要 主要看数学和英语的成绩 主要还是笔试面试的成绩2.要提前修掉一些课3.展示自己的知识能力还有抗压能力4.还要把自己的快速学习能力和潜力展示出来 这个主要看自己能不能完成项目了针对性 1.两个软件 一个微信小程序 一个Java或者安卓程序2.学掉数据结构(用c++)和计算机网络3.从明天开始 每天一题4.听一遍专业导论课
2017-10-14 15:45:35 841
原创 关于JavaScript的作用域链的一点小总结
首先要知道 JavaScript并没有块及的作用域,只有函数级作用域 也就是说在下面的代码中if(condition){ var a = 3;}a为的作用域为全局 函数级作用域起作用的方式 执行环境(executioncontext) 变量对象(variableobject, VO),与执行环境相关联,执行环境中定义的所有变量和函数
2017-10-08 13:47:54 128
原创 CSS盒模式总结
一.盒模式有哪些内容1.内容区可以用width 属性来确定内容区的宽度可用background-image:url()来添加背景图片2.边框border-color:border-style:border-width:border-radious:边框圆角3.内边距:padding4.外边距:margin附加:块级元素的特点1
2017-09-16 21:33:17 360
原创 css当中的单位
1.web颜色使用rgb来制定颜色 即三原色按照比例混合所得到的颜色可用百分数来表示 例如 rgb(0%,0%,0%)还可以用数值来制定颜色 例如rgb(256,256,256) 数字是0到256中的一个数字还可以用十六进制来表示颜色 如#cc6600 每两位表示一种颜色2.距离单位px 表示像素 在css中默认90px=1英寸em 是相对大小 1em总
2017-09-16 15:29:16 177
原创 线性表的链表实现形式
#include#includeusing namespace std;typedef int ElementType;typedef struct LNode *ptrToNode;struct LNode{ ElementType Data; ptrToNode Next;};typedef ptrToNode List;//头指针typedef ptrToNo
2017-08-24 19:00:49 181
原创 线性表的数组实现方式
#include#includetypedef int Position;//表示位置的数据类型typedef int ElementType;//表示顺序表的数据类型typedef struct LNode LNode,*List;#define MAXSIZE 100struct LNode{ ElementType data[MAXSIZE]; Position
2017-08-24 16:24:47 358
原创 学习Java继承和多态时的一个小demo
很智障的一个小demo啊啊啊啊啊主要是为了理解继承和多态做的一个小demoDataBase.javapackage demo;import java.util.ArrayList;public class Database { private ArrayList listIteam=new ArrayList<>();//多态性,父类的引用变量可以指向子类的对象,
2017-08-19 18:41:26 233
原创 将函数作为参数传递/以及计算函数运行时间的函数的实现
需要写一个九三函数运行时间的函数,那么就需要把函数作为参数查了一下把函数作为参数的方法把函数作为参数传递,常用的方法之一是用typedef定义一个函数指针。#includeusing namespace std;typedef int (*pf)(int,int); //此种方式最容易理解,定义了一个函数指针类型;函数名就是指针。int f(pf p,int
2017-07-28 23:10:36 249
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人